AD9481: 8-Bit, 250 MSPS, 3.3 V A/D Converter
Product Description
The AD9481 is an 8-bit, monolithic analog-to-digital converter (ADC) optimized for high speed and low power consumption. Small in size and easy to use, the product operates at a 250 MSPS conversion rate, with excellent linearity and dynamic performance over its full operating range.
To minimize system cost and power dissipation, the AD9481 includes an internal reference and track-and-hold circuit. The user only provides a 3.3 V power supply and a differential encode clock. No external reference or driver components are required for many applications.
The digital outputs are TTL/CMOS-compatible with an option of twos complement or binary output format. The output data bits are provided in an interleaved fashion along with output clocks that simplifies data capture.
The AD9481 is available in a Pb-free, 44-lead, surface-mount package (TQFP-44) specified over the industrial temperature range (−40°C to +85°C).
Product Highlights
1. Superior linearity. A DNL of ±0.35 makes the AD9481 suitable for many instrumentation and measurement applications
2. Power-down mode. A power-down function may be exercised to bring total consumption down to 15 mW.
3. De-multiplexed CMOS outputs allow for easy interfacing with low cost FPGAs and standard logic.
Applications
- Digital oscilloscopes
- Instrumentation and measurement
- Communications
- Point-to-point radios
- Digital predistortion loops
Features
- DNL = ±0.35 LSB
- INL = ±0.26 LSB
- Single 3.3 V supply operation (3.0 V to 3.6 V)
- Power dissipation of 439 mW at 250 MSPS
- 1 V p-p analog input range
- Internal 1.0 V reference
- Single-ended or differential analog inputs
- De-multiplexed CMOS outputs
- Power-down mode
- Clock duty cycle stabilizer
